Design Management GroupOverviewIt is widely recognised that the design of great products and services is a key factor in the success of firms. The way in which the product development process is managed is critical to this success. Increasingly, design is also recognised as being important at a national level. The Design Management Group in the Institute for Manufacturing is interested in how design can be effectively managed to create sustainable, desirable, usable and producible new products and services. Central to this aim is the role of design as an integrator between technology and users. We are also active in understanding and promoting the importance of design at a national level.
